Cabin Demolition in Cypress, TX

Cabin demolition services involve the safe and efficient removal of small to medium-sized structures, typically made of wood or similar materials. This service is often requested for projects such as clearing out old or unused cabins, sheds, or similar buildings on residential properties.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of the demolition process, including how the structure will be dismantled, debris removal, and site cleanup, to ensure the area is prepared for future use or development.

Before requesting cabin demolition, property owners should consider factors like the size and construction of the cabin, the presence of any hazardous materials, and local regulations or permits required for demolition work. It’s also helpful to clarify whether the project involves complete removal or partial demolition, and to discuss any concerns about neighboring properties or landscape preservation. Having these details in mind can facilitate a smoother process and ensure the project meets specific property needs.

FAQ

Cabin Demolition Questions

What types of cabins can be demolished? Cabin demolition services typically handle various structures including wooden cabins, log homes, and small outdoor shelters.

Is the process disruptive to the surrounding property? Demolition is planned to minimize disruption and protect nearby landscaping and structures.

What should property owners do before demolition? Clearing the area of personal belongings and ensuring access to the cabin are recommended steps before demolition begins.

Are permits required for cabin demolition? Permit requirements vary by location; contacting local authorities can clarify necessary approvals for the project.
